О Компании Как Купить Скидки Продукты Услуги Тех.Поддержка Вопросы Карта Сайта

Услуги по конвертированию/переносу данных

Основываясь на своем многолетнем опыте, команда Intelligent Converters предоставляет услуги по конвертированию/переносу данных между следующими СУБД: FoxPro (.DBF), IBM DB2, Microsoft Access, Microsoft SQL, MySQL, Oracle и PostgreSQL. Так же данные любого из этих форматов могут быть экспортированы в Microsoft Excel или .CSV форматы.

Когда могут потребоваться услуги по конвертированию/переносу данных:

  • Вы хотите быть уверены на 100% в том, что все данные обработаны корректно и результирующая база данных будет работать стабильно
  • Вы планируете перенести базу данных на новую систему, но не уверены, какие действия необходимо выполнить для этого и в какой последовательности
  • Вы попробовали воспользоваться одним из продуктов Intelligent Converters, но столкнулись с ошибкой по причине базовой несовместимости исходных данных с целевым форматом (посмотрите Примеры подобной несовместимости)
  • Вам необходимо извлечь данные из поврежденных дамп файлов Oracle

Свяжитесь со службой технической поддержки Intelligent Converters для бесплатной консультации и определения цены за конкретную задачу конвертирования/переноса данных.

Гарантии

Многолетний опыт и обширные знания специалистов компании Intelligent Converters в области преобразования данных между различными форматами позволяют гарантировать высокое качество результата за приемлемую стоимость. В случае недовольства результатами услуг по конвертированию/переносу данных компания гарантирует 100% возврат денег.

Конфиденциальность

Команда Intelligent Converters предоставляет продукты и услуги тысячам пользователей по всему миру, от крупнейших компаний до малых бизнесов и физических лиц. Вы можете быть уверены, что Ваши данные в надежных руках. Если Вам необходимы дополнительные гарантии, представители Intelligent Converters могут подписать Соглашение о Конфиденциальности Информации до того, как Вы предоставите данные для конвертирования.

Стоимость

Каждая задача по конвертированию/переносу данных индивидуальна, поэтому здесь не существует фиксированных тарифов. Стоимость работ зависит от объема и сложности данных, которые необходимо обработать. Заполните форму ниже, чтобы получить стоимость работ для Вашей конкретной задачи:

Источник:  
Цель:  
Кол-во таблиц:  
Среднее
кол-во записей в таблице:
 
Детали:
(отношения между таблицами,
запросы/представления,
большие бинарные объекты и т.д.)
 
Ваше имя:  
E-mail:    

Примеры

Ниже приведены примеры ситуаций, когда автоматическое конвертирование не представляется возможным.

  1. Допустим, осуществляется перенос базы данных Microsoft SQL на сервер MySQL, и в одной из таблиц под primary key находится последовательность числовых значений 0,1,2,3. Проблема заключается в том, что в отличии от MS SQL MySQL не допускает нулевого значения в полях с атрибутом auto increment. Когда осуществляется попытка присвоить нулевое значение полю с атрибутом auto_increment, MySQL заменяет 0 на первое допустимое (не дублирующееся) значение. Таким образом, последовательность 0,1,2,3 будет преобразована в 1,1,2,3 (первая единица появляется в результате замещения 0 значением пока еще отсутствующим в таблице). Это приведет к конфликту дублирующих значений в составе primary key. Решить эту проблему можно, удалив атрибут auto_inrement с соответвтвующего поля и заменив primary key на аналогичный униакльный индекс.
  2. При переносе таблицы Oracle с большим количеством полей на MySQL сервер возможно появление ошибки: "Row size too large". Причиной этого является ограничение размера записи в MySQL в 65535 байт, не считая полей типа BLOB и TEXT. Решением этой проблемы может быть изменение типов некоторых полей в результирующей таблице MySQL на BLOB и TEXT при условии, что подобные изменения не повлияют на логику работы с базой данных.
  3. При конвертировании таблицы, содержащей более чем 255 полей, в формат Microsoft Access, появляется ошибка "Too many fields defined", потому что допустимое количество полей в таблице MS Access не должно превышать 255. Для решения этой проблемы специалисты Intelligent Converters могут либо объеденить некоторые поля, либо разбить данные на 2 и более таблиц. Более предпочтительный вариант зависит от структуры рассматриваемой таблицы и базы данных в целом, сделать правильный выбор возможно только после аудита базы данных.

Как можно видеть, в процессе переноса данных из одной СУБД в другую есть много узких мест. Чтобы быть уверенным в том, что все компоненты базы данных будут преобразованы в целевой формат корретно, обратитесь к специалистам Intelligent Converters по адресу . Мы предлагаем бесплатный аудит данных для последующего конвертирования, или консультации по решению конкретных проблем преобразования данных.